About this day nursery

Cliffe House Day Nursery, established in 2014, provides a warm and nurturing environment for children aged 0-4 years. Open Monday to Friday, 51 weeks a year, with sessions from 7:30 am to 6 pm, the nursery focuses on creating a safe and happy space where children can learn and thrive.

The dedicated staff team, who care deeply for the children, ensure good supervision levels and positive interactions, supporting play and development. Children learn about the nursery's 'golden rules', which helps them understand expectations and manage their feelings and behaviour.

The nursery also boasts a wonderful outdoor play area, where children can engage in a wide range of physical activities such as climbing, riding wheeled toys, balancing, and jumping, fostering their physical development and large-muscle skills. The nursery excels in its support for children with special educational needs and/or disabilities (SEND), with leaders and staff precisely monitoring progress to quickly identify those needing targeted support.

Outside agency referrals are made promptly, and additional funding is used for one-to-one care or suitable resources, ensuring all children, including those with SEND, make good progress. The nursery provides funded early education for two-, three- and four-year-old children.

Inspector highlights

  • Children learn about the 'golden rules' of the nursery and behave well.
  • Children thoroughly enjoy playing in the nursery's wonderful outdoor play area and develop physical skills.
  • Staff accurately monitor children's progress, identify those needing targeted support or with SEND, and ensure appropriate intervention.
  • Leaders provide staff with a dedicated fund for well-being resources and experiences, and staff receive regular supervision and training.
  • Parents and carers have access to the nursery's lending library and are able to provide feedback that contributes to action plans.

Areas to develop

  • 1strengthen the planning for children's experiences and activities to ensure a sharper focus on the skills and knowledge that staff want children to learn
  • 2review the organisation of activities and transition times to ensure that children's needs are consistently met to the highest levels.

How they support every child

SEND provision

Leaders and staff monitor children's progress precisely. As a result, they are able to quickly identify any children who need more targeted support or children with special educational needs and/or disabilities (SEND). Leaders ensure that outside agency referrals are made at the right time to provide appropriate intervention. They use additional funding to provide one-to-one care or suitable resources to support children's learning. This ensures that children with SEND continue to make good progress.

Outdoor space

Children thoroughly enjoy playing in the nursery's wonderful outdoor play area. They take part in a wide range of experiences to support their physical development, such as climbing, riding on wheeled toys, balancing and jumping.
